QUEBEC CITY, Dec. 12, 2013 /CNW Telbec/ - EXFO Inc. (NASDAQ: EXFO, TSX: EXF) today announced the addition of multimode test capabilities to its unique fiber characterization tool, the iOLM, making it the ideal troubleshooting tool for fiber-to-the-antenna (FTTA) and data center networks.
Essentially, this means that EXFO's FTB-720 LAN/WAN Access test module now supports full iOLM functionalities on both singlemode and multimode fibers. Launched in 2011 for singlemode, the iOLM was designed to simplify OTDR testing by removing the need to set parameters as well as analyze and interpret multiple complex OTDR traces. By combining multiple pulse widths on multiple wavelengths with advanced algorithms, the iOLM correlates all OTDR results to locate and identify faults with maximum resolution, all at the push of a single button. The iOLM enables fiber technicians of all skill levels to characterize end-to-end fiber links the same way an experienced OTDR technician would.
To cope with multimode networks increasing requirements, EXFO also announced that its solution now fulfills encircled flux compliance. The encircled flux standard (EF), as recommended by the Telecommunications Industry Association (TIA-526-14-B) and the International Electrotechnical Commission (IEC 61280-4-1), is a method of controlling light source launch conditions to eliminate variations in test results that tend to occur when using different sources in multimode environments. EXFO developed a compact and lightweight external launch mode conditioner, the SPSB-EF, which can be paired with an FLS-600 light source or any EXFO multimode OTDR to create a precise, repeatable and cost-effective EF-compliant test solution.
"By making the iOLM available for multimode fibers, network operators and contractors working in fiber-to-the-antenna (FTTA) or distributed antenna systems (DAS) environment can ensure that problems are identified faster than ever before" said Étienne Gagnon, EXFO's Vice-President, Physical Layer and Wireless Division. "When paired with EF conditioner, EXFO's iOLM-MM also boosts Tier-2 certification and troubleshooting for data center applications, which is critical to improve mean time to recovery (MTTR) and avoid the high cost of downtime."
To serve the basic Tier-1 certification market, EXFO is also releasing a new version of the FLS-600 Light Source. This handheld light source offers built-in EF-compliant launch conditions that ensure proper loss measurement according to the latest standards. Find out more at EXFO.com/iOLM and EXFO.com/EF.
About EXFO
Listed on the NASDAQ and TSX stock exchanges, EXFO is among the leading
providers of next-generation test and service assurance solutions for
wireline and wireless network operators and equipment manufacturers in
the global telecommunications industry. The company offers innovative
solutions for the development, installation, management and maintenance
of converged, IP fixed and mobile networks—from the core to the edge.
Key technologies supported include 3G, 4G/LTE, IMS, Ethernet, OTN,
FTTx, VDSL2, ADSL2+ and various optical technologies accounting for
more than 35% of the portable fiber-optic test market. EXFO has a staff
of approximately 1600 people in 25 countries, supporting more than 2000
customers worldwide. For more information, visit www.EXFO.com and follow us on the EXFO Blog, Twitter, LinkedIn, Facebook, Google+ and YouTube.
